Defining the Metaverse: Beyond the Hype
At its core, the metaverse is not a single application or platform, but rather a convergence of technologies and experiences. It's an evolution of the internet, moving from a flat, 2D experience to an embodied, 3D one. Key characteristics include its persistent nature – it continues to exist and evolve even when you're not logged in – and its interoperability, aiming for seamless transitions between different virtual spaces and the ability to carry digital assets across them. It’s a space where digital and physical realities increasingly blend.
Think of it as the next iteration of the internet, where instead of browsing web pages, you inhabit digital spaces. This shift implies a profound change in how we interact, consume information, and conduct commerce. Early iterations, like popular online games and social VR platforms, offer glimpses into this future, demonstrating the potential for deep engagement and novel forms of connection.
Distinguishing from Virtual Reality
While Virtual Reality (VR) is a key enabling technology for the metaverse, it is not synonymous with it. VR provides immersive experiences through headsets, offering a powerful way to enter virtual worlds. However, the metaverse can be accessed through various devices, including augmented reality (AR) glasses, PCs, and even mobile phones, albeit with varying degrees of immersion. The metaverse is the interconnected digital universe; VR is one of its primary gateways.

The Pillars of Metaverse Construction
Building a functional and engaging metaverse requires several foundational pillars that ensure its scalability, longevity, and economic viability. These are the conceptual frameworks upon which persistent, interconnected virtual worlds are erected.
Interoperability: The Seamless Fabric
One of the most critical, yet challenging, aspects of the metaverse is interoperability. This refers to the ability for digital assets, identities, and experiences to move seamlessly between different virtual worlds. Imagine taking an avatar you designed in one game and using it in another, or transferring a digital artwork purchased in one space to display in your virtual home in another. True interoperability would break down the silos of current digital platforms, creating a more unified and expansive virtual universe.
Achieving this requires standardized protocols and open architectures, a significant undertaking given the proprietary nature of many current virtual environments. Without it, the metaverse risks becoming a collection of disconnected "walled gardens," diminishing its transformative potential. It's the digital equivalent of being able to use your passport across different countries.
Persistence: The Always-On Reality
Unlike a typical video game session that ends when you log off, the metaverse is persistent. It exists and evolves continuously, independent of individual user presence. Changes made within the metaverse remain, communities continue to interact, and economies operate. This persistence fosters a sense of real-world consequence and continuity, making digital interactions feel more meaningful and impactful.
This necessitates robust infrastructure capable of handling constant data flow and state changes. It means that digital real estate, businesses, and social structures can be built and maintained over time, mirroring the permanence of their physical counterparts. The persistence of the metaverse is what lends it a sense of reality and gravitas.

Blockchain and NFTs: Ownership and Authenticity
Blockchain technology is fundamental to establishing trust, transparency, and verifiable ownership within the metaverse. Non-Fungible Tokens (NFTs) are a direct application of blockchain that allows for the creation and ownership of unique digital assets. This is what enables the concept of digital scarcity and provides proof of authenticity for virtual items, from digital art to in-game assets and virtual land.
NFTs are not just for collectibles; they can represent ownership of virtually anything digital, from a unique avatar skin to a piece of virtual real estate. This capability is crucial for building the metaverse's economy, ensuring that creators and users can truly own and trade their digital creations and acquisitions. The secure and decentralized nature of blockchain ensures that these ownership records are immutable and transparent.

Economic Models and Monetization Strategies
The economic engine of the metaverse is as crucial as its technological underpinnings. Understanding how value is created, exchanged, and sustained is vital for both participants and developers. The metaverse offers a fertile ground for innovative economic models.
Virtual Real Estate and Digital Assets
Virtual real estate is a burgeoning sector within the metaverse. Users can purchase, develop, and monetize plots of land in popular virtual worlds. This digital land can host businesses, art galleries, event venues, or private residences. The value of virtual real estate is driven by factors such as location (proximity to popular hubs), traffic, and the potential for development and monetization.
Beyond land, the trade of digital assets, enabled by NFTs, is a cornerstone of the metaverse economy. This includes everything from unique avatar clothing and accessories to digital art, collectibles, and in-game items. The ability to truly own these assets, and potentially trade them on secondary markets, creates a decentralized economy where value is directly tied to digital scarcity and demand.
Creator Economies and Direct-to-Avatar Commerce
The metaverse is poised to supercharge the creator economy. Artists, designers, developers, and entrepreneurs can build businesses directly within virtual worlds, selling their creations and services to a global audience. This "direct-to-avatar" (D2A) commerce model bypasses traditional intermediaries, allowing creators to retain a larger share of their revenue.
This shift empowers individuals to monetize their creativity and skills in novel ways. Imagine a fashion designer creating digital couture for avatars, a musician performing virtual concerts, or an architect designing virtual buildings. The metaverse provides the canvas and the marketplace for these new forms of digital entrepreneurship, fostering a more equitable and accessible economic landscape.
Challenges and the Road Ahead
Despite the immense potential, the metaverse faces significant hurdles that must be addressed for its widespread adoption and positive societal impact. These challenges span technical, ethical, and regulatory domains.
Accessibility and Digital Divide
A fundamental challenge is ensuring that the metaverse is accessible to everyone, not just a privileged few. The cost of high-end VR/AR hardware, the need for reliable high-speed internet, and the digital literacy required to navigate these spaces can exacerbate existing inequalities, creating a new digital divide. Efforts must be made to develop more affordable hardware and user-friendly interfaces that cater to diverse technological capabilities and socioeconomic backgrounds.
Furthermore, ensuring inclusivity for individuals with disabilities is paramount. Designing virtual environments and interfaces that are navigable and enjoyable for all is an ongoing challenge that requires thoughtful design and testing. The goal is to build a metaverse that truly serves as a global commons, not an exclusive club.
Privacy, Security, and Ethical Considerations
The unprecedented collection of personal data within immersive virtual worlds raises serious privacy concerns. User behavior, interactions, and even biometric data can be tracked, creating opportunities for sophisticated surveillance and manipulation. Robust data protection measures, transparent data usage policies, and user control over their digital footprint are essential. The security of digital assets and identities is also a paramount concern, requiring advanced cybersecurity protocols to prevent theft and fraud.
Ethical considerations extend to issues of harassment, misinformation, and the potential for addiction or disengagement from physical reality. Establishing clear community guidelines, effective moderation systems, and promoting digital well-being will be critical for fostering healthy and safe virtual environments. The principles of digital citizenship must be as rigorously applied in virtual spaces as they are in the physical world.
Regulatory Landscapes and Governance
As the metaverse expands, so does the complexity of its governance and regulation. Questions surrounding intellectual property rights, taxation of virtual assets, antitrust issues, and jurisdiction in a borderless digital space are emerging. Existing legal frameworks may not be adequate to address the unique challenges posed by these virtual economies and societies.
Developing effective governance models, which could involve decentralized autonomous organizations (DAOs) or hybrid approaches, is crucial for ensuring fairness, accountability, and the rule of law in the metaverse. Collaboration between technologists, policymakers, and legal experts will be necessary to chart a path forward that fosters innovation while protecting users and society.
